ALL ABOUT DENTURES
Daily cleaning removes plaque, food particles, and bacteria that collect on the surface of your dentures. Using a soft brush and a non-abrasive denture cleanser helps maintain their appearance and freshness.
Consistent cleaning also supports healthier gums and reduces the risk of irritation or unpleasant odours. A clean denture not only looks better but feels more comfortable throughout the day.

Allow Your Gums to Rest
Remove Dentures at Night
Taking your dentures out before bed gives your gum tissue time to recover from daily pressure. Continuous wear can lead to soreness and inflammation over time.
